23. ge 73 Risk of scalding Allow the detergent solution to coo down Turn off the tap Information about blockages Detergent solution pump Turn the programme selector to Off and disconnect the mains plug 1 Open and remove the service flap J Take the drainage hose out of the retainer Remove the sealing cap allow the detergent solution to flow out Push the sealing cap back on Carefully unscrew the pump cover residual water Clean the interior pump cover thread and pump housing the impeller in the detergent solution pump must rotate x 2 Replace the pump cover and screw it on tightly The handle is vertical Place the drainage hose back into the retainer Place the service flap back on and close se To prevent unused detergent from flowing straight into the drain during the next wash Pour 1 litre of water into compartment II and start the WY Drain programme Drainage hose at the siphon Turn the programme selector to Off and disconnect the mains plug 1 Loosen the hose clamp carefully remove the drainage hose residual water 2 Clean the drainage hose and siphon connecting piece 3 Heattach the drainage hose and secure the connection with the hose clamp Filter in the water supply Risk of electric shock A Do no immerse the Aqua Stop safety device in water it contains an electrical valve Reduce the water pressure in the supply hose 1 Turn off the

30. lothing separately light Do not prewash If required select the additional lt D SpeedPerfect function Pre treat any stains as necessary Do not load as much laundry Select the program with Prewash heavy Soaking Load laundry of the same colour Pour soaking agent detergent into compartment Il in accordance with the manufacturer s instructions Turn the programme selector to f Cottons 30 C and press Dil Start Reload After approx 10 minutes press Dl Start Reload to pause the programme Once the required soaking time has elapsed press Dl Start Reload again to continue the programme or select a different programme Starching Starching is possible in all wash programmes if liquid starch is used Pour starch into the fabric softener compartment in accordance with the manufacturer s instructions rinse first if necessary Dyeing bleaching Dye should only be used in normal household quantities Salt may damage stainless steel Always follow the dye manufacturer s instructions Do not use the washing machine for bleaching clothes i Load indicator The load sensor detects how heavily the washing machine is loaded The laundry is not weighed Recommended dosage Based on the selected programme and the detected load the recommended dosage function provides a recommendation for the detergent dosage in The figure refers to the recommendation of the detergent manufacturer Automatic load sensing Indepe
31. ndently of the load indicator the automatic load sensing function uses additional sensors to adapt the water and power consumption ideally to each programme depending on the type of fabric and the load 9 Laundry must not be treated with fabric softener Tm 2 Insert for liquid detergent model dependent Position the insert for dispensing liquid detergent Remove the detergent drawer completely gt page 70 Slide the insert forwards Do not use the insert slide upwards for gel detergents and washing powder for programmes with J Prewash or the end time option Risk of electric shock Disconnect the mains plug Risk of explosion No solvents Machine housing control panel Wipe with a soft damp cloth Do not use any abrasive cloths scourers or cleaning agents stainless steel cleaners Remove detergent and cleaning agent residue immediately Do not clean with a jet of water Cleaning the detergent drawer If it contains detergent or fabric softener residues Pull out press insert down remove drawer completely To remove the insert press the insert uowards from below with your finger Clean the detergent dispenser tray and insert with water and a brush and dry it Attach the insert and engage connect the cylinder to the guide pin Push in the detergent drawer Leave the detergent drawer open so that any residual water can evaporate
